Light Armored Vehicle (LAV) Training Equipment Survey for the U.S. Marine Corps LAV-25.

Abstract

This report is the second and final report for the Training Device Requirements Analysis Project. The objectives of the project was to provide recommendations on training devices which could be used to train turret operation/gunnery skills and associated operator maintenance on the Light Armored Vehicle (LAV-25). Following a training equipment survey, this report provides an assessment of the feasibility of using existing training devices for LAV training by developing samples training device options. It also provides recommendations on the use of evaluate factors which will be used both in the acquisition of training devices and in the evaluation of proposed training devices. Products of the Training Equipment Survey include: List of existing training devices which have potential application to LAV-25 training. Description of a training device which would provide training for turret operation/gunnery and operator maintenance. Potential training device options which could provide training for institution and unit training sites. Definition of preliminary training goals, requirements, constraints, and cost and non-cost criteria such that training device options can be evaluated and ranked. (Author)
